Malwina
Strawberry Plants
The ultimate late-season strawberry. Delivering large, glossy berries with remarkably high Brix levels, Malwina gives you rich, full-bodied sweetness in every bite. As one of the latest fruiting June-bearing varieties, it’s perfect for extending your harvest. Beyond taste, it also stands strong in the field, showing resistance to mildew with a good tolerance to both verticillium wilt and red stele. Zones 4-6
